Origin and Evolution

Close-up of intricate crystal detailing on eyewear
Close-up of intricate crystal detailing on eyewear

The origin of sunglasses has roots deeply embedded in practical need. Ancient societies crafted rudimentary forms to shield their eyes from the sun. For example, the Inuit people used flattened walrus ivory to block harmful rays while maintaining visibility. This early ingenuity laid the groundwork for future innovations.

As societies progressed, so did the technology behind lenses. By the 16th century, glass became a preferred material for enhancing vision and minimizing glare. The invention of darkened goggles became popular among the upper classes, merging both aesthetics and function. The modern concept of sunglasses, with UV protection, emerged much later in the 20th century after increased awareness of eye health.

Key milestones in the evolution of sunglasses include:

  • 1920s: High fashion houses began designing stylish eyewear, making sunglasses an integral part of the wardrobe.
  • 1930s: Ray-Ban introduced the Aviator style, originally made for pilots but soon adopted by the general public for its sleek design.
  • 1950s-1960s: Celebrities popularized various styles, including oversized frames and mirrored lenses, enhancing the appeal beyond functionality.
  • 2000s onward: Crystal-embellished designs emerged, reflecting an ongoing trend where ornamentation meets practicality.

With each phase of evolution, sunglasses have adapted to societal demands while maintaining their core function. Today, they are distinct in their ability to combine flair with essential eye protection, especially with sophisticated embellishments like crystals.

Material Selection

Material selection plays a crucial role in defining the quality and appeal of crystal sunglasses. The materials used for the frame, lenses, and of course, the crystals themselves, contribute to the sunglasses' durability, comfort, and visual impact. Much effort is put into selecting high-quality plastics, metals, and glass crystals.

For example, luxury brands often opt for titanium frames. They are lightweight and strong. Acrylic is another common material due to its flexibility and lightness. When talking about the crystals, brands often use Swarovski crystals, known for their superior shine and clarity. Using genuine materials not only enhances aesthetic value but also ensures longevity.

Craftsmanship Techniques

Craftsmanship techniques in creating crystal sunglasses are essential in ensuring the final product is of high quality. Attention to detail is paramount. Techniques can vary widely, ranging from traditional handcrafting to modern precision technologies. Hand-placing crystals is labor-intensive but allows for unique patterns that mass production methods cannot easily replicate.

Additionally, laser-cutting methods are often employed to create precise cuts in the frames and lenses, ensuring an exact fit for the embellishments. Each technique contributes to the overall elegance of the sunglasses while also ensuring that they meet the demands of everyday wear.

By leveraging advanced crafting skills, brands successfully create eyewear that is not only functional but also resonates with the artistic sensibilities of consumers.

Innovative Materials

Innovative materials are at the forefront of modern sunglasses design. Many brands are exploring materials such as nylon and polycarbonate, which are lightweight yet offer exceptional impact resistance. Such features are essential for sunglasses adorned with crystals, which can often make the frames heavier.

Additionally, the use of coatings, such as anti-reflective and scratch-resistant layers, ensures that these fashionable pieces remain functional over time. These coatings not only protect the lens but also enhance clarity and visibility for the wearer.

Another notable mention is the rise of biodegradable materials. As consumers become more environmentally conscious, brands are pressured to adopt sustainable practices. Biodegradable frames made from plant-based materials are emerging, offering an eco-friendly alternative without sacrificing style. Incorporating crystals into these materials requires creativity and precision, leading to more unique designs that appeal to modern consumers.
